WaSHI: Making Soils Data Actionable

April 3 @ 12:00 pm 1:00 pm

REGISTER for free: wasoilhealth.org

More soil tests and data are available to farmers than ever. While this can be empowering, it can also be confusing. New information on soil chemistry, biology, and physics can sometimes be difficult to translate into action.

In this webinar series, we highlight projects across Washington that are using soil data to inform real, on-farm management decisions.

WEBINAR 4:

Speaker: Jadey Ryan, Data Scientist, Washington State Department of Agriculture

Join this webinar for a demo of the {soils} R package, designed for comprehensive soil health data visualization and reporting. See how we use R and Quarto to create customized, interactive reports to empower each participant in the State of the Soils Assessment to explore and understand their soil data. {soils} will be released to the public in March.
